Navigating the Numbers: Understanding Freight Lane Pricing in Today’s Market

Facebook Twitter Pinterest WhatsApp Copy Link
Navigating the Numbers: Understanding Freight Lane Pricing in Today’s Market
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est WhatsApp Copy Link


The supply chain landscape is evolving at an unprecedented pace, driven by technological advancements, shifting consumer demands, and global market dynamics. At the heart of this transformation is the intricate pricing structure of freight lanes, a crucial component that affects the bottom line of businesses across various industries. To navigate the complexities of freight lane pricing, it’s essential to understand the factors that influence rates and how shippers can optimize their logistics investments.




The Basics of Freight Lane Pricing


Freight lane pricing refers to the cost associated with transporting goods between specific origin and destination points. This pricing can fluctuate based on several factors, including distance, mode of transportation, and the nature of the cargo. In a broad sense, freight costs can be categorized into four primary components:



  • Base Rate: The fundamental price determined by carriers, reflecting operational costs.

  • Accessorial Charges: Additional fees for services such as loading, unloading, and special handling.

  • Fuel Surcharges: Variable fees applied to offset rising fuel costs, often adjusted weekly or monthly.

  • Market Demand: Prices can rise or fall based on supply and demand dynamics within the logistics market.




Factors Affecting Freight Lane Pricing


Several elements come into play when analyzing the pricing of freight lanes:


1. Distance and Route


The distance between the origin and destination is a primary factor in determining shipping costs. Longer distances usually yield higher freight costs, although the specific route taken can also impact pricing. For example, routes through densely populated areas might incur higher tolls and fuel costs.


2. Mode of Transportation


Shippers have various options—road, rail, air, and sea—each with its pricing structure. Air freight is typically the most expensive due to speed and service, while ocean freight, particularly for bulk cargo, often provides the most economical rates.

3. Cargo Characteristics


The type of cargo being shipped can significantly influence pricing. Hazardous materials, perishables, and oversized items usually demand specialized handling and therefore incur higher costs. Conversely, standardized cargo may benefit from lower rates due to regularity and predictability in handling.


4. Seasonal Variability


Freight lane prices are often subject to seasonal fluctuations. The holiday season typically leads to increased demand for shipping services, resulting in higher rates. Conversely, off-peak seasons might provide opportunities for negotiating better pricing.




Optimizing Freight Lane Costs


In a volatile market, shippers must be proactive in managing their freight costs. Here are several strategies to optimize logistics budgets:


1. Utilize Technology


Investing in Freight Management Software (FMS) can yield valuable insights into freight lane pricing trends. These tools can provide real-time data, allowing companies to make informed decisions while enabling easier negotiations with carriers.


2. Negotiate Rates


Freight rates are not set in stone. By leveraging historical data and understanding market trends, shippers can negotiate favorable rates with carriers. Establishing long-term relationships might also earn discounts or favorable terms over time.


3. Consolidation Strategies


Shippers can reduce costs by consolidating shipments. By grouping freight from multiple suppliers, shippers can fill containers or trucks more efficiently, minimizing overall shipping expenses and decreasing per-unit costs.


4. Stay Informed on Market Trends


Monitoring industry reports and carrier announcements provides shippers with invaluable information about potential rate changes and service disruptions. Being informed enables companies to plan ahead and react swiftly to market dynamics.




The Future of Freight Lane Pricing


The rise of e-commerce and the demand for faster shipping options have fundamentally changed the freight landscape. As technology continues to evolve, shippers can expect a further shift in pricing structures. Here are some trends to watch:

1. Automation and AI


As logistics companies adopt automation and AI, the precision in pricing will improve. Predictive analytics could facilitate more dynamic pricing models, allowing shippers to anticipate cost fluctuations more accurately.


2. Sustainability Initiatives


There is a growing emphasis on sustainable logistics practices. Companies actively pursuing green initiatives may face different pricing structures based on their sustainable choices, which could either add costs initially or lead to significant savings in the long run through efficiency.


3. Continued Fragmentation of the Market


With an increasing number of carriers entering the market, shippers may experience greater price variances. This fragmentation can create opportunities for buyers who are diligent in their research and negotiations.




In Conclusion


Understanding freight lane pricing is no simple task; however, it is crucial for businesses seeking to maximize operational efficiency and cost-effectiveness. By grasping the factors that influence their shipping costs and actively seeking strategies to optimize expenses, shippers can navigate the numbers with confidence. As market conditions continue to evolve, staying adaptable and informed will be key to success in a competitive logistics landscape.
